Aston Villa signs up Dafabet as new main sponsor

Dafabet is to become the new official main club sponsor of Aston Villa, after the Asian online betting company reached a two-year agreement with the English Premier League football team.

The Dafabet logo will appear on the front of players’ home and away jerseys – replacing existing main sponsor, fellow Asian gaming company Genting Casinos. The Philippines-headquartered company will also enjoy a host of other sponsorship benefits as part of the deal.

Paul Faulkner, Aston Villa chief executive, confirmed Dafabet had also displayed “strong willingness” to work with the club in its support of Acorns Children’s Hospice, a charity Aston Villa has backed since 2006.

Dafabet first entered the Premier League market last season through its partnerships with Everton and West Bromwich Albion.

John Cruces, head of sponsorships at Dafabet, said: “To be associated with one of the oldest and most successful clubs in England will help us achieve our aim of making Dafabet a household name – not just in Asia, where the majority of our players are currently from, but worldwide.”
